Digital detox clinics are wellness facilities designed to help individuals disconnect from digital devices. These retreats provide a technology-free environment to restore mental clarity, focus, and emotional balance.
Participants experience structured programs that include mindfulness practices, nature walks, and social interactions without screens. Clinics often provide therapy sessions, yoga, and meditation to support holistic mental health recovery.
With constant digital connectivity, many people face anxiety, stress, and sleep disruption. Digital detox clinics address these challenges by offering a safe space away from phones, laptops, and social media pressures.
These clinics also educate participants on healthy technology habits, equipping them with strategies to balance digital usage post-retreat. The emphasis is on long-term wellness and sustainable lifestyle changes.

Health Benefits of Digital Detox Programs
Detox programs improve focus, reduce stress, and enhance emotional resilience. Participants report better sleep, improved mood, and greater self-awareness after technology-free retreats.
Screen-free environments promote deeper connections with nature and others. Engaging in physical activity and mindful practices strengthens both mental and physical well-being.
Psychological studies indicate reduced cortisol levels and decreased anxiety symptoms after extended digital detox periods. Retreats provide a scientifically-backed environment to achieve these outcomes.
Detox clinics also teach coping mechanisms for digital overuse. By learning mindful device habits, participants sustain their mental health improvements long after the retreat concludes.
Popular Activities at Mental Health Retreats
Mindfulness and meditation are central to most digital detox programs. Guided sessions help individuals observe thoughts and emotions without judgment, fostering inner calm.
Nature immersion through hiking, forest bathing, and outdoor yoga allows participants to reconnect with their surroundings. These activities reduce stress and increase a sense of presence.
Creative workshops, including painting, journaling, and music therapy, encourage self-expression. Participants often discover hobbies and talents they neglected due to digital distractions.
Therapy sessions, both individual and group-based, address underlying mental health concerns. Structured reflection and counseling help individuals identify patterns contributing to digital dependency.
Technology-Free Lifestyle Beyond the Retreat
Digital detox clinics emphasize sustainable lifestyle changes. Participants learn practical strategies to manage screen time, notifications, and social media engagement effectively.
Many retreats introduce digital fasting schedules, mindfulness-based productivity techniques, and structured device check-ins to maintain balance in daily life.
Support groups and follow-up programs extend the retreat experience. Regular check-ins reinforce lessons learned, preventing relapse into unhealthy digital habits.
Ultimately, the goal is to cultivate digital awareness and conscious technology use. Participants return home with tools to prioritize wellness while staying connected responsibly.
